- 浏览: 68629 次
- 性别:
- 来自: 北京
最新评论
-
hanmiao:
import java.math.BigDecimal;
p ...
设置double类型数字精度 -
sunshan:
这三个工具都很好很强大!
java打包-exe文件-最终以setup形式发布的解决之道 -
yaoandw:
好东西,帮了我大忙,多谢
java二进制,字节数组,字符,十六进制,BCD编码转换收藏 -
fandayrockworld:
哇,困扰多时的问题终于找到了,谢谢博主了。太牛了,怎么找到问题 ...
Word2007鼠标失效 不能定位光标位置 解决办法(转) -
sky51shine:
遇到同样的问题,感谢楼主
Word2007鼠标失效 不能定位光标位置 解决办法(转)
文章列表
1. Webservice增加到项目中后,部署到weblogic12c下,在启动或者部署时报错:
Caused By: org.apache.commons.logging.LogConfigurationException: org.apache.commons.logging.LogConfigurationException: org.apache.commons.logging.LogConfigurationException: Class org.apache.commons.logging.impl.Log4JLogger does not implement Log
执行步骤: ...
级别: 中级 李 学朝 (lixuec@cn.ibm.com), 高级软件工程师,IBM中国软件开发中心
2006 年 11 月 21 日
本文介绍了如何在WebSphere应用服务器中实现应用程序内存泄漏的探测,并且针对IBM所提供的系列分析与诊断工具,给出了具体的配置 ...
Ftp继承类包: org.apache.commons.net.ftp.FTPClient
在java中由Windows系统机器向Unix等系统机器利用ftp传输文件时,由于两个系统对回车换行的理解是不一样的,所以传输到Unix系统上用vi打开时会出现'^M'字符。
在FTPClient类中有一个setFileType函数可以设置文本传输的类型,只要将其设置为FTPClient.ASCII_FILE_TYPE文本模式传输,在Unix中打开文件就没有'^M'字符了。
FTPClient API 链接地址:http://commons.apac ...
页面中可选可输入文本框的实现
- 博客分类:
- 编程
页面设计时,在实际应用中我们常常要用到输入框、下拉选择框等控件;但有时候为了满足特别的要求我们会用到可选可输入的“下拉选择输入框”,设计源码如下:
<html>
<head>
</style>
</head>
<body>
<h1>测试可选可输入文本框<br><br><br></h1>
<tr>
<td>请输入或直接选择</td>
<td align="cente ...
- 2009-09-28 11:31
- 浏览 2846
- 评论(0)
最近一段时间写程序遇到了不少页面设计的东西,自然少不了js。
在做的过程中使用脚本是总是遇到错误,开始时一头雾水,不知道如何从jsp页面中取定位js的错误位置,因为ie给定位的错误位置有时候很模糊,但是目前有没有针对js语法调试的编辑器。自己摸索了几天,有两个方法比较实用而且有效:
1、alert()方法;
alert方法添加到脚本中合适的位置(你怀疑有错误的地方),页面执行时会弹出一个对话框,看看alert()方法是否被执行到;这样在页面中放几个alert你就可以很快的检测到错误发生的位置,准确排除!注意:错误排除后记得把alert去掉啊,要不然页面一顿弹对话框也很要命的 ...
- 2009-09-27 17:21
- 浏览 1708
- 评论(0)
当 String 中使用split函数分割字符串时,遇到一个问题。当分隔符为“|”时,如例所示
String acc = "1|15110101|1";
String acclist[] = acc.split("|");
for(int i=0; i<acclist.length; i++) {
System.out.println(acclist[i]);
}
出现了如下效果:
1
|
1
5
1
1
0
1
0
1
|
1
原来使用"|"当分割符时需要加入"\\"进行转义 ...
给你们解一下疑问,毕竟我也摸索过好一阵
原来的tomcat-user.xml是
<?xml version="1.0" encoding="utf-8" ? >
- <tomcat-users >
<role rolename="tomcat" / >
<role rolename="role1" / >
<user username="both" password="tomcat" roles ...
- 2009-07-27 15:44
- 浏览 8114
- 评论(0)
命令行启动关闭tomcat而不显示cmd界面
启动:tomcat.bat
"C:\Program Files\Java\jdk1.5.0_16\bin\java.exe" -Xms128m -Xmx384m -jar -
Duser.dir="E:\tools\2008\apache-tomcat-5.5.26" "E:\tools\2008\apache-tomcat-5.5.26
\bin\bootstrap.jar" start
关闭:stop tomcat.bat
"C:\Progr ...
- 2009-06-26 08:38
- 浏览 3913
- 评论(0)
Word2007鼠标失效 解决办法(转)
一直在使用word2007,但用了一段时间,发现经常鼠标在Word2007的编辑区无法使用,无法用鼠标定位光标插入点,无法右解点击,无法选择文本,总之,就像你没有鼠标一样。结果只能关掉文档重新打开,就可以用一会,只是不知道什么时候它又会失效。总不能这样鼠标一失效就关掉重开吧。。。。于是上网搜了一下,才发现问题的所在,因为Powerdesigner12.5惹的祸。不过,同时装这两个东西的人,还真不多,所以碰到问题的人也不多,我算幸运的一个了。
解决方法就是,打开Word2007,趁鼠标还有效的时候,点击[开始]按钮,点击 【word选项】找到COM加载 ...
- 2009-06-05 10:52
- 浏览 9692
- 评论(6)
Q: 什么是混淆器?
A: 由于Java程序运行时是动态连接的,因此编译成的目标文件中包含有符号表,使得Java程序很容易被反编译,混淆器可以打乱class文件中的符号信息,使反向工程变得非常困难。
Q: 现有的混淆器有什么问题?
A: 现有的混淆器都是对编译好的class文件进行混淆,这样就需要编译和混淆两个步骤。并不是所有的符号都需要混淆,如果你开发的是一个类库,或者某些类需要动态装载,那些公共API就必须保留符号不变,这样别人才能使用你的类库。现有的混淆器提供了GUI或脚本的方式来对那些需要保留的符号名称进行配置,如果程序较大时配置工作变得很复杂,而程序一旦修改配置工作又要重新进行。某 ...
- 2009-04-09 10:47
- 浏览 6474
- 评论(0)
Hibernate不同数据库的连接及SQL方言收藏
<session-factory>
<property name="connection.driver_class">net.sourceforge.jtds.jdbc.Driver</property>
<property name="connection.url">jdbc:jtds:sqlserver://ALEX:1134/News</property>
<!--for oracle 9
<property nam ...
- 2009-04-08 10:57
- 浏览 1192
- 评论(0)
标签: C3P0 连接池 配置
一.在tomcat_home\common\lib下放入jdbc的驱动程序,额外说一下,如果是使用sql server的话,有至少两个驱动可以选择,一个是微软提供的,另一个是 jtds,比微软的要好很多,推荐使用
二.配置文件,tomcat 不同的版本配置文件略有不同,下面以tomcat5.5.*为例,如果配置不正确会出现javax.naming.NameNotFoundException: Name is not bound in this Context 错误
方式一、全局数据库连接池(Mysql数据库)
1、通过管理界面配置连接池,或者直接在tom ...
- 2009-04-08 09:18
- 浏览 2577
- 评论(0)
字符集出现错误解决办法
出现的问题:
mysql> update users
-> set username='关羽'
-> where userid=2;
ERROR 1366 (HY000): Incorrect string value: '\xB9\xD8\xD3\xF0' for column 'usern
ame' at row 1
向表中插入中文字符时 ...
- 2009-03-25 15:09
- 浏览 4333
- 评论(0)
java二进制,字节数组,字符,十六进制,BCD编码转换2007-06-07 00:17/** *//**
* 把16进制字符串转换成字节数组
* @param hex
* @return
*/
public static byte[] hexStringToByte(String hex) {
int len = (hex.length() / 2);
byte[] result = new byte[len];
char[] achar = hex.toCharArray();
for (int i = 0; i < le ...
- 2009-01-15 19:37
- 浏览 6239
- 评论(1)
把byte转化成string,必须经过编码。
例如下面一个例子:
import java.io.UnsupportedEncodingException;
public class test{
public static void main(String g[]) {
String s = "12345abcd";
byte b[] = s.getBytes();
String t = b.toString();
System.out.println(t);
}
}
输出字符串的结果和字符串s不一样了.
经过以下方式转码就可以正确转换了:
...
- 2009-01-15 13:55
- 浏览 4306
- 评论(2)